About TS52

Tomball Regional Hospital Heliport (TS52) is a heliport in Tomball, TX, at 182 ft MSL. It has 1 runway, the longest 100 ft, with no control tower (pilot-controlled). Does TS52 have a control tower?

No. Tomball Regional Hospital Heliport is a non-towered (pilot-controlled) heliport; use the published CTAF/UNICOM on the Comms & NavAids tab.

What is the longest runway at TS52?

Tomball Regional Hospital Heliport has 1 runway; the longest is 100 ft. See the Runways tab for headings, surface, and lighting.

Where is TS52?

Tomball Regional Hospital Heliport is in Tomball, TX, at an elevation of 182 ft MSL. Coordinates: 30.0867, -95.6214.
